node.js - Nodejs识别客户端ssl
问题描述
我有一个 Node js 后端。我使用 OAuth 2 进行身份验证。除一个端点外,所有端点都受此身份验证方法的保护。我无法在这个不安全的端点中使用 OAuth,因为该端点是由我无法控制的另一台服务器触发的。所以我不能告诉其他服务器向我发送一个令牌以供我的后端验证。
对我的后端的请求是通过 SSL 连接发出的。那么,在 Nodejs 中是否有任何方法可以找出 SSL 颁发者名称或类似名称,以便我的后端可以验证请求者?(对我的不安全端点的所有请求都来自同一台服务器)
解决方案
推荐阅读
- java - java中的切换方法
- python - 需要帮助在 python webbrowser.open 中放置一个verable
- python - Python“从 x 导入 y”与“从 .x 导入 y”
- vim - 我不明白为什么 Vim 脚本中的 job_start 会发生这样的事情?
- css - 与父级分隔容器宽度
- javascript - Laravel REST API 何时为值列表创建单独的控制器?
- java - Stream.forEach() 中的 `return;` 将控制中断到哪里?
- r - glmer() 以一个因子水平作为基线收敛,但在将基线重新调整到另一个水平时无法收敛
- java - Spring Boot MVC - 不支持请求方法“POST”
- python - 在生成梯度下降函数和成本方面需要帮助